Gordon Ramsay is one of Britain's best known chefs.

His latest cookery book is about desserts but his reputation is far from sweet.
He first shot to fame when a TV documentary revealed his fiery temper as he shouted and sacked members of his staff.
Since then he's kicked a well known food critic and Joan Collins out of his restaurant and made inflammatory comments about not liking women chefs because they only work three weeks a month due to PMT.
Jenni finds out whether he really does have a temper and hold these views, or whether it's all for show.
She'll also be tasting some of his desserts!
'Just Desserts', by Gordon Ramsay (Quadrille Publishing Ltd; ISBN: 1903845106; £25.00)
